Select Fins: A good set of
fins (or flippers!) will move you easily through the water and be
comfortable on your feet. To select your fins, consider the following: |
Snorkelers usually wear full-foot fins or soft adjustable fins, which are designed to wear
over a bare foot or soft fin sock.
Full-foot fins are sized by men's shoe size. Adjustable fins are usually Small, Medium, and Large.
There is no right or left foot in fins.
Some fin designs have wider foot pockets while others are narrower.
If you snorkel in places with rough entry points, or you prefer more
support or foot protection, choose open-heel adjustable strap fins, worn
with a neoprene boot with full sole or a neoprene water shoe.
Your fins should fit snugly but comfortably. Too loose, and the
fin will wiggle through the water when you kick and rub against your foot.
Too tight, and the fins will be hard to put on wet feet, and may cause toe
cramps.

If you have a little extra space in the fin, try a
pair of fin socks to protect your feet and improve the fit. |
